How much do process eng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for process engineer in St. Louis, MO is $89,462.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$72,400.00 and $100,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a process engineer?

Process Engineers are professionals who design, implement, and optimize industrial processes to improve efficiency, quality, and safety in manufacturing or production environments. They analyze workflows, troubleshoot process issues, and develop solutions to enhance productivity and reduce costs. Process Engineers often work in industries such as chemicals, pharmaceuticals, food and beverage, and energy, ensuring processes are compliant with environmental and safety regulations. Their work is vital for maintaining smooth operations and achieving organizational goals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a process eng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Process Engineer, you need a solid background in chemical, mechanical, or industrial engineering, often supported by a relevant bachelor's degree and understanding of process optimization principles. Familiarity with process simulation software (such as Aspen Plus or AutoCAD), Six Sigma methodologies, and quality management systems is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ills set candidates apart in this role. These skills and qualifications are essential to improve efficiency, ensure safety, and drive continuous improvement in industrial and manufacturing processes.

What are some common challenges process engineers face when implementing process improvements, and how can they overcome them?

Process Engineers often encounter challenges such as resistance to change from team members, integrating new technologies with existing systems, and ensuring process changes meet regulatory standards. Overcoming these obstacles typically involves clear communication, involving stakeholders early in the process, thorough documentation, and piloting changes before full-scale implementation. Building strong cross-functional relationships and continuously gathering feedback also help ensure that improvements are effective and sustainable.

What is the difference between Process Engineer vs Manufacturing Engineer?

AspectProcess EngineerManufacturing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's in Engineering, certifications like Six SigmaBachelor's in Engineering, certifications like Lean Manufacturing
Work EnvironmentDesigning and optimizing processes, R&D settingsOverseeing production lines, factory floors
Industry UsageManufacturing, chemical, aerospaceAutomotive, electronics, consumer goods

Process Engineers focus on designing and improving manufacturing processes, often working in R&D or engineering departments. Manufacturing Engineers concentrate on implementing and managing production on the factory floor. Both roles require similar technical skills and certifications but differ mainly in their scope and work environment.

Work Environment

The role is based in a GMP-regulated biopharmaceutical manufacturing environment that includes ISO-classified cleanroom spaces. The Process Engineer gowns into ISO spaces regularly, typically at least once per week, and follows established cleanroom protocols. This includes removing items such as earrings, cosmetics, and certain hair products prior to entry to maintain contamination control and meet strict environmental standards. Work involves close interaction with manufacturing operations, process equipment, and chromatography systems, with a strong emphasis on safety, quality, and adherence to documented procedures. The environment is highly regulated, structured, and collaborative, requiring consistent attention to detail, compliance with gowning and hygiene requirements, and clear communication across technical and operational teams.
